Godrej Eyes Lucrative Growth in Energy Solutions Despite Sector Challenges
Godrej Enterprises Group targets 20% growth in its energy solutions sector, with a robust project pipeline of Rs 2,600 crore for FY26. Despite war-related uncertainties and domestic supply constraints, the focus remains on renewable energy in Gujarat, Rajasthan, and transmission infrastructure expansion in several Indian states.

Godrej Enterprises Group is targeting a 20% growth in its energy solutions business, aiming for a Rs 2,600 crore project pipeline by the end of fiscal year 2026, according to a senior company official on Tuesday. The organization closely monitors West Asian geopolitical tensions, although current operations remain unaffected by the situation.
The spread of Godrej's projects includes building renewable energy infrastructure in Gujarat and Rajasthan, while Maharashtra, Uttar Pradesh, and Tamil Nadu are investing in transmission infrastructure due to rising industrial and urban demand. With a focus on eng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) projects, the company's initiatives include constructing power substations up to 765 kV.
Challenges persist, however, with supply chain constraints and a lack of skilled labor posing threats to anticipated growth. The company's proactive measures include working with vendors to increase capacity. Despite these issues, the domestic-centric aspect of the power sector and high localization percentage of equipment offer stability and reduced risk exposure.
